New York City students are pressing the Metropolitan Transportation Authority to upgrade student OMNY transit cards, arguing that the current design is too fragile for daily school commutes. According to reports from ABC7 New York anchored by David Novarro, young riders and advocates point out that the standard-issue contactless payment cards bend, snap, and break easily in backpacks and pockets, disrupting reliable access to public transit.

Transit Hardware Realities and the Cost of Fragility
Infrastructure durability is rarely evaluated through the lens of a teenager’s school bag, but in mass transit, physical card integrity dictates operational flow. When an OMNY card snaps or delaminates, it fails to register at the turnstile. This forces station agents to intervene or pushes students toward paper single-ride tickets, introducing friction into the system.
For a massive agency like the MTA, small hardware failures multiply quickly. Supplying replacement cards eats into administrative budgets, while damaged plastic contributes to unnecessary material waste. As transit systems globally pivot toward contactless standards—similar to implementations managed by transport authorities in London and Chicago—card longevity becomes a core component of supply chain management.
Evaluating the MTA’s Digital and Physical Infrastructure
The OMNY rollout has fundamentally changed how riders pay fares across the city’s subways and buses. Yet, concession cards issued to specialized user groups, such as students, often lag behind the ruggedized standards seen in commercial debit and credit cards.
Here is the math: replacing millions of transit cards annually requires stable supplier contracts and robust PVC or composite materials. If student cards fail prematurely, the recurring replacement cost strains operational expenditures.

Broader Economic Pressures on Public Transit Budgets
Capital upgrades require funding that urban transit networks fight hard to secure. The MTA operates under intense scrutiny regarding its operating budget, farebox recovery ratios, and modernization timelines.
Upgrading student OMNY cards to more durable, perhaps thicker or dual-interface smart cards, involves negotiating new terms with technology vendors. While transit advocates frame the issue around student equity and reliable school access, the finance department views it as a procurement challenge.
According to transit observers, municipal systems cannot afford friction in fare collection systems as electronic tolling and tap-and-go gates become the baseline for urban mobility. Every broken card is a micro-failure in a multi-billion-dollar transit ecosystem.
